Komando.com, Website for The Kim Komando Radio Show�, Kim's Tips Embedding video in a Web page 11/28/2006 Q. My wife manages a Web site for a high school volleyball team. We are trying to load digital videos for college recruiters. It is better than making copies on DVD and mailing them out. I've gotten the videos on my computer, but I can't seem to upload them to the site. Can you help? A. This sounds like a great idea. And uploading video doesn't need to be difficult. You have several options. Advertisement This isn't an advanced solution, but it will do the trick. But there's a better solution. There is an online tool that will generate the code to play your video directly on your Web page. You simply upload the videos into a folder on your Web site. Select the program you want to play the video. The player must match the format of your video. For instance, if your video is in .MOV format, you should select QuickTime. Then enter your site name and the location and name of the video. It will generate the HTML to plug in to your Web page. You can also load the video onto a video-sharing site. YouTube is the most popular right now. But you can also use Google Video and Vimeo. For more on these sites, read my recent tip. You'll have to do some work to get your video uploaded. The video site will provide you with code. You drop the code into your page to embed the video. Now for some pointers. You want to keep video sizes small. Otherwise, they will take a long time to load. Viewers will lose patience. Next, choose a video format that is fairly universal. Flash is a good format. Any computer will be able to see the video. MOV also is good, because QuickTime works on both Windows and Mac. Macs come with QuickTime Player. Get the free QuickTime Player for Windows here. If you need video-editing programs, visit my Downloads section. And also, make sure you're using the right video card for editing.

Ajaxian � JavaScript Tip: Watch out for “ ” avaScript Tip: Watch out for “ ” Category: JavaScriptView the technorati tag: JavaScript, ExamplesView the technorati tag: Examples, TipView the technorati tag: Tip Dynamic languages are the cool thing du jour. All dynamic languages are not born equal, and JavaScript is one that happens to be weakly typed. This means that you can keep throwing new types at a variable and JavaScript takes it in its stride. You sometimes get into some problems though, and one of the common ones appears when you have weird behaviour with something somethingelse. We recently ran into an example of this issue when debugging an application that was running fine in all browsers bar Safari. We are good citizens and want everyone to be able to access the application so dug in. It turned out that the root issue was seen in: When we debugged in Safari, we ended up seeing the result of this as: “203002348504397534050px0px0px” The other browsers had sane results like “2233″ The problem was with types and Safari was adding together the world as Strings vs. numbers. Glenn Vanderburg has lots of fun examples of wacky things happening here.
